Ariel Pocock

Living In Twilight

2017-08-10

A very nice Jazz album from Ariel. She reminds me of The Gary Burton Quartet, but of course with a woman singer. She certainly has her voice trained to hit the high notes, and loves to express that. There are quite a few songs which are incorporating Love on the album, but that is to no discount of the musicianship which is pretty good overall. Only a few tracks are instrumental. I thought it was pretty good. Check out tracks 1, 3, 6, and 9 for a few good tunes.
